Amada Mendez de Giron, 94, of Cleveland, Tennessee, died on Sunday July 5, 2015.

Until her death, she was the Oldest Guatemalan Pentecostal alive. Born in Santa Cruz del Quiché, Guatemala on October 27, 1920 to a Roman Catholic family, she became part of the Pentecostal church in 1936, at the age of 16, under the ministry of Rev. Thomas Pullin, a pioneer of the Church of God in Guatemala. In 1942, she married Jorge Giron, who was a Church of God minister since 1939. Together they were instrumental in planting more than 400 churches for the Church of God in Guatemala. They served the Church of God for 56 years.
